Chemnitz | Industrial Museum | 25.04. – 16.11.2025
The special exhibition Tales of Transformation at the Chemnitz Industrial Museum impressively shows how European industrial cities have undergone a transformation - from traditional production sites to modern centres of innovation. A history that imk Industrial Intelligence not only told, but actively shaped.
imk and, in particular, its founder Dr Jens Trepte made a conscious decision to locate the company's headquarters in a historic building. Spinning mill a symbol of the industrial spirit of bygone times, which is now a home for modern High-tech software solutions serves. This is precisely where the ema Software Suite a pioneering technology for the digital planning, simulation and optimisation of manual production processes with a unique human model.
What was once a spinning mill is now a centre for Digital factory planningwhere the latest methods are used to optimise production processes and shape the industry of tomorrow. This combination of historical architecture and pioneering technology makes imk a living example of the transformation shown in the special exhibition.
